The painting depicting the red bodied Vajravarahi, the Diamond Sow, distinguishable by the small boar’s head protruding from her hair. Vajravarahi in all her manifestations is an important deity for tantric initiation, especially for new initiates. Naked save for her skull diadem and a gold jewellery, a celestial scarf billowing about her, Vajravarahi dances in the ardhaparyanka posture, balancing her left foot on the orb of the sun above a lotus. She brandishes a diamond chopper in her right hand while holding a blood-filled skull cup in her left. A small inscription to the reverse.
